Welcome to the City of Covington, Tennessee! Founded in 1825, Covington is the proud county seat of Tipton County and a community where history and progress meet. Just a short drive north of Memphis, our city offers the charm of a classic small town with the convenience of nearby urban life. Stroll through our beautiful historic downtown square, where you’ll find unique shops, local dining, and year-round events that bring neighbors and visitors together.

Covington is also home to vibrant parks, family-friendly recreation, and cultural experiences that celebrate our rich heritage and bright future. With a strong sense of community, ongoing investment, and a welcoming spirit, Covington continues to grow while keeping its small-town heart.
